 The Spectrum of Choices

When diving into the world of outdoor ceiling lights for the porch, the options can be overwhelming. The choices range from traditional lantern-style fixtures to modern, minimalist LED arrays. Here’s how to navigate these waters:

  1. Style Matters: Match the lighting with your home's architectural style. A Victorian home might pair well with ornate, classic designs, while a modern abode may benefit from sleek, angular lights.
  2. Functionality First: Consider the primary purpose of your lights. If it's security, opt for brighter, more expansive lighting solutions. For ambiance, softer, warmer lights could be ideal.
  3. Technological Integration: Modern outdoor ceiling lights for the porch often come with features such as motion sensors, solar power options, and smart home compatibility. These technologies offer not only convenience but also energy efficiency and enhanced security.

 Light Quality and Color

The color temperature and quality of your lights play a crucial role in setting the desired ambiance. A golden, warm light (around 2,700 to 3,000 Kelvin) usually creates a cozy, welcoming feel, reminiscent of candlelight or the setting sun. On the other hand, cooler temperatures (above 4,000 Kelvin) emit a brighter, white light, enhancing clarity—perfect for reading or tasks. 

 Durability and Weather Resistance

Given that these lights will be outdoors, it's essential to ensure they can withstand various weather conditions. Prioritize fixtures that are water-resistant, rust-proof, and rated for outdoor use. Brands often label products with an IP rating, indicating how well the light resists dust and water penetration. For instance, an IP65 rating would be dust-tight and protect against water jets.

 Expert Tips and Recommendations

According to Lucy Martin, a renowned lighting designer, the key to perfect porch lighting is "layering." This involves combining ambient, task, and accent lighting to achieve a well-rounded and adaptable lighting scheme.

 Ambient Lighting: This is the primary source of light and sets the overall tone. Think of it as the canvas upon which other lights will play.

 Task Lighting: As the name suggests, this type targets specific tasks like reading. Pendant lights or focused downlights can serve this purpose.

 Accent Lighting: These are the finishing touches. Spotlights highlighting architectural features or soft uplights can add depth and character to your porch.
